The Inertia of Mass and the Newtonian Force
In this paper a relation between inertia of mass and force is presented. In educational contexts, the inertia is generally associated with momentum and energy. However, a direct connection between inertia and force can be also verified in a simple instance of collision. The description of this situation, from the action-reaction pair forces perspective, enlarges the meaning of inertia and highlights the coherence of Newtonian mechanics and the interrelation between concepts and their three laws.

期刊介绍: The Revista Brasileira de Ensino de Física - RBEF - is an open-access journal of the Brazilian Physical Society (SBF) devoted to the improvement of Physics teaching at all academic levels. Through the publication of peer-reviewed, high-quality papers, we aim at promoting Physics and correlated sciences, thus contributing to the scientific education of society. The RBEF accepts papers on theoretical and experimental aspects of Physics, materials and methodology, history and philosophy of sciences, education policies and themes relevant to the physics-teaching and research community.
